Iran's Airports Holding Company (IAHC) announced plans to classify and standardise Iran's airports. IAHC will do this by first assessing the strengths and weaknesses of each airport, as according to Deputy Director, Ali Golmohammadi, the level of service at the airports is currently "acceptable, but not excellent".
